AI-Boosted Gaming with XeSS
Intel’s XeSS (Xe Super Sampling) is a clever AI-enhanced technology that enhances the sharpness of images and frame rates without taxing the GPU any further.
It therefore implies that regardless of how average your laptop is, you are still capable of enjoying clean, crisp graphics.
Furthermore, XeSS is designed to upscale images cleverly so games appear as though they’re in higher resolutions without sacrificing performance. This means lower lag, responsiveness, and increased visual fidelity.

Wide Support for Recent Games
There are some budget GPUs that cannot run newer game titles, but Intel Arc can play current games without any issues. As it’s constructed with DirectX 12 and Vulkan support, you don’t have to be concerned about the crashes of games or compatibility problems.
Most older budget graphics cards do not have optimized drivers, so you might find a few games working slowly or not at all. But Intel provides constant updates to support the newest games so that your Arc GPU always remains compatible.
